Historical Context Through git history analysis, I discovered that the `-EINVAL` error code was introduced in **2018 by Tetsuo Handa** (commit 7464726cb5998) to fix a critical syzbot-reported bug where `hfsplus_fill_super()` was returning 0 (success) when detecting invalid filesystem images, causing NULL pointer dereferences. The choice of `-EINVAL` was somewhat arbitrary—the primary goal was to return *any* error instead of 0. ### 2. What This Commit Fixes This commit corrects the error semantics at fs/hfsplus/super.c:527, changing from `-EINVAL` to `-EIO` when the hidden directory's catalog entry has an incorrect type (not `HFSPLUS_FOLDER`). This is filesystem metadata corruption, not invalid user input. ### 3. Code Pattern Analysis Examining the HFS+ codebase reveals a clear pattern: - **-EIO usage**: 27+ instances across super.c, btree.c, xattr.c, dir.c, catalog.c, etc., consistently used for on-disk corruption - **-EINVAL usage**: Used for invalid mount options (options.c) and invalid user-provided arguments - **Line 527 was the exception**: It incorrectly used `-EINVAL` for what is clearly filesystem corruption This pattern is consistent with other filesystems: NILFS2 extensively documents "`-EIO` - I/O error (including metadata corruption)" while reserving `-EINVAL` for invalid arguments. ### 4.
